Autograph Postcard by Moravia Alberto - 1932
Located in Roma, IT
Autograph Postcard Signed by Alberto Moravia to the Countess Pecci Blunt. Cortona, Italy, July 7th 1932. In Italian. Perfectly readable, excellent condition, including original envelope. From Villa Morra Metelliano in Cortona, Alberto Moravia writes this postcard of greeting and thanks to the Countess Pecci-Blunt, or Mimi, the patron of arts and the closed-friend of artists and intellectuals. The Italian writer thanks her for the wise and pleasant people met during the Parisian stay, at one of the Countess' residences. The background: During the period of this correspondence, Moravia has just started his carres as journalist: in 1927, Moravia met Corrado Alvaro and Massimo Bontempelli and they founded the magazine 900. The journal published his first short stories, but his life changed when he published in 1929 Gli Indifferenti, noteced by the critic. In 1930 Moravia started collaborating for the newspaper La Stampa, then edited by author Curzio Malaparte...

Thick Outside
Located in Milford, NH
A fine Cape Cod scene with fisherman heading out on the dock in heavy fog by American artist Tod Lindenmuth (1885-1976). Lindenmuth was born in Allentown, Pennsylvania, and later worked in Provincetown and Rockport, Massachusetts, with a home in St. Augustine. A founder of the Provincetown Art Association and one of the original Provincetown Printers, Lindenmuth was a semi-abstract painter and graphic artist who did much to promote modernist styles and was well known for his modernist, semi-abstract and marine subject paintings. Lindenmuth studied with Robert Henri and was a member of the Salmagundi Club and the Rockport Art Association. He was also active in Provincetown until 1941, and then retired to Florida in the 1960s, having spent his winters there since the 1930s. Correspondence by Massimo Bontempelli - 1930s
Located in Roma, IT
Collect this Correspondence by Massimo Bontempelli to the Countess Pecci-Blunt. This lot is composed of 6 items, in Italian, written from 1934 to1937. Excellent conditions, perfectly readable. Including original envelopes. In details: Autograph Telegram Signed. Frascati, 1934. Autograph Telegram Signed. Viareggio, August 17th 1934 Autograph Letter Signed. Frascati, April 25th 1934. One page, single-sided. On letterhead paper " Reale Accademia d'Italia". Autograph Greeting Postcard Signed. Altomare, January 3rd 1935. Signed by Montempelli and his wife. Autograph Letter Signed. Rome, January 13th 1935. One page, single-sided. On letterhead paper " Reale Accademia d'Italia". Autograph Letter Signed. Milan, May 30th 1937. One page, single-sided. On letterhead paper " Reale Accademia d'Italia". From the Royal Academy of Italy, Massimo Bontempelli writes to the Countess Pecci-Blunt, meditating on congresses and literary conferences and declining invitations to sumptuous lunches, because of previous commitment. During this period, Bontempelli was close to the Fascism, and as a member of this political movement and for literary honors he gained the chair for the Royal academy of Italy. He served as a secretary of the fascist writers' union and spent time abroad lecturing on Italian culture. promoting Italian Culture was the common mission of the Countess Pecci-Blunt and Bontempelli. However, in 1938 he was kicked out of the Fascist party, drifting towards Communism. Massimo Bontempelli (1878 - 1960) Italian poet, playwright, novelist and composer, Massimo Bontempelli was influential in developing and promoting the literary style known as Magical Realism. After the war, he settled in Milan and became interested in the Futurist and Magical realist literary styles. In 1926, along with Curzio Malaparte...
